Handover note — Crumbwheel order cutoffs.

Welcome aboard. The bakery cutoff rule in Crumbwheel closes same-day orders at 14:00 local to each storefront, not UTC — this has bitten us twice. Holiday overrides live in the calendar service and take precedence silently, so always check there first when a cutoff looks wrong. To unlock the calendar service's admin console after a restart, enter the recovery passphrase below.

vault phrase of bagap-bahaf = silion-pelox-sorox-casdor-quenwyn-fraax-eliox-praael-kelion-quenvan-kasox-rusael-norius-belvan

Off-site run checklist — Item 3: Sealed-bid tender, Marwick civic works

Dispatch desk: confirm tender envelope is sealed, wax intact, and countersigned on the flap. Place in the locked document satchel; satchel key stays with dispatch, not the driver. Deadline at Gartan Hall is 15:00 sharp — no exceptions, late bids are void. Record departure and arrival times on the run sheet. Courier confirms the confidential hand-over instruction given immediately below before release.

handover note for yagef-bagep: the drudor pelius courier leaves the kasdor zorvan norir ledger at gate 8016 under passcode 755406

# Onboarding: Spokewise Rebalancer

Spokewise is our internal tool that tells the van crews which bike-share docks in Calder Bay need bikes moved before the morning rush. Support mostly fields questions about stale dock counts and stuck rebalancing jobs. You can run a local copy against the staging feed to reproduce most tickets. Clone the repo, install dependencies, and copy env.sample to .env. The staging feed requires authentication, so after the copy step, append the feed credential on the line that follows.

sealed setting: ARCHIVE_KEY3=8d0

Runbook: GraphScope dependency visualizer — stuck render

Symptoms: graph page spins, edge count shows zero.

1. Check the resolver pod logs for cycle-detection timeouts.
2. Restart the layout worker; it leaks memory on graphs over 10k nodes.
3. If the cache looks stale, flush the edge index and re-trigger ingestion.
4. Still broken? Escalate to the platform rotation with the pod name and the build token shown below.

build token for kagaf-hahof: htk14_9d3d4d26d7d8de